Page 9 text:

DEDICATION MR. GEORGE W. DAVIS, M.C.H.S. - 1900 JL»a IT GIVES us great pleasure to honor in this Rocket one of Montgomery County High School's outstanding alumni— Mr. George W. Davis, of the Class of 1900. Mr. Davis is manager of the United States Reemployment Service for Montgomery County and is one of the four members of the State Apprentice Training Staff. A man of tireless energy, he spends fully as much of his time in educational affairs (for which he receives no pay) as he does in his regular work. Men of his caliber are few in any community and because for 35 years he has proved himself an enthusiastic defender of the best interests of our high school we dedicate to him the Rocket of 1935.

Page 10 text:

FOREWORD HIS YEAR marks the three hundredth anniversary of the American High School. It is also interesting to know that it is the sixtieth anniversary of Montgomery County High School. We have taken this for the theme of our year book and have contrasted the old schooling systems with the new. For three hundred years the schools have quietly educated the youth of America unnoticed and unrecognized by outsiders. However, this year they arc receiving nation-wide attention. Following is a copy of the letter President Roosevelt addressed to all American high schools: THE WHITE HOUSE WAlMINOTON A1CRICAN HIGH SCHOOL ANNIVERSARY The year 1936 ushers In an important anniversary in the life of the American people. Three hundred years ago the first American high school — the Boston Latin School — was founded. It ni established In 1636 only fifteen abort years after the landing of the Pilgrims. Free a small beginning eltb one Instructor and a handful of students has grown the splendid service noe pro Tided for more than 6,000,000 young Americans by 26,000 public and private high schools. These schools are developing the most precious resource of our nation, the latent Intelligence of our young people. It Is worth noting that social progress In the United States Is folloelng selftly on the heels of the remarkable expansion of educational opportunity at the high school level. I hope that the young people of every high school In the United States 111 celebrate this three hundredth anniversary. I hope they •111 celebrate it In a manner which will bring vividly before parents and fellow townsmen the significance, the contribution and the goals of their schools. November 20. 1934.
